This introductory astronomy textbook is aimed at undergraduates across a range of disciplines. It encourages the development of vital science-based critical-thinking skills, and outlines our present-day understanding of our universe and the profound questions still to be answered in this ancient, yet rapidly changing field.

  • Develops critical thinking skills throughout the text to help students learn to distinguish between false claims that derive from faulty evidence or conjecture and verifiable statements based on expert research and study
  • Emphasises the crucial role of science and its integration into modern society
  • Strives to prompt curiosity in the reader, by demonstrating that our understanding of the universe is far from complete
  • Features some basic mathematics, together with interpretive language, and supplemented with numerous examples
  • Additional tutorials are provided on the book's companion website
  • Features end-of-chapter exercises to reinforce learning and embed understanding
  • Solutions manual available on request from the OUP website

About the Author(s)

Dale A. Ostlie, Emeritus Professor of Physics, Weber State University

Professor Ostlie earned his BA degree from St. Olaf College in 1977 and his PhD in theoretical astrophysics from Iowa State University in 1982. Following a two-year position at Bates College, Ostlie went to Weber State University in 1984, where he remained until his retirement in 2014. Along with teaching astronomy, physics, and mathematics courses, Ostlie conducted research in stellar pulsation theory, served as Chair of the Physics Department and Dean of the College of Science. Ostlie also co-authored a highly successful introductory astrophysics textbook with WSU colleague, Bradley W. Carroll. Ostlie continues an active career in textbook writing today.
